x
Close

Britannia School of Academics

World London, ENG, UK   UK ... more

Britannia School of Academics

World London, ENG, UK   UK

Britannia School of Academics

World London, ENG, UK   UK ... more

Britannia School of Academics

World London, ENG, UK   UK